When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Cowaramup?
Good weather’s definitely a plus when you’re experiencing new places, so here are some stats that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ually February and January with an average temp of 68°F, while the coldest months are August and September with an average of 58°F. Average annual precipitation for Cowaramup is 27 inches.
What is there to see and do in Cowaramup?
Overall, Cowaramup is known for its wineries, rivers, and gardens. Get out into nature with places like Bramley National Park, Gracetown Beach, and Gloucester Park. Cultural attractions include Yallingup Galleries, Jahroc Galleries, and Wardan Aboriginal Centre. Locals like to shop at Margaret River Farmers Market and The Margaret River Chocolate Company.
What's the best way to get to and around Cowaramup while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in Cowaramup on hand to make the most of your stay: You can search for flights to the nearest airport, which is Busselton, WA (BQB-Margaret River), 20.1 mi (32.4 km) away from the city center.
